The video tutorial by Chip Candy explores the versatile use of potato sacks for fitness activities. It begins with an introduction to potato sacks, traditionally used for relay races, and demonstrates various exercises such as jumping, ski jumps, and star jumps. The tutorial includes a potato sack race and advanced fitness activities like sideways jumping and circular movements. The video emphasizes the adaptability of potato sacks for fitness and field day events.
